i-mobile Co., Ltd. engages in the mobile advertising by creating and providing reliable and satisfying services via the Internet. The company is headquartered in Shibuya-Ku, Tokyo-To and currently employs 215 full-time employees. The company went IPO on 2016-10-27. The firm operates is business in two business segments. The Consumer segment is involved in the hometown tax payment business Furunabi, the netcatcher business, the recruitment business focusing on the operation of the Website WARAJIN, as well as the restaurant Public Relation (PR) business focusing on the operation of the Website Teppan. The Internet Advertising segment is involved in the advertising network business, the agency business, the video advertising business maio, the operation of the advertising serving platform mobile Affiliate, the media solution business, as well as the agency business.
